fre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

java網(wǎng)上書店管理系統(tǒng)設(shè)計(jì)與實(shí)現(xiàn)(doc畢業(yè)設(shè)計(jì)論文)(編輯修改稿)

2025-07-19 18:30 本頁(yè)面
 

【文章內(nèi)容簡(jiǎn)介】 cedescriptimagecontentsauthorid圖 書本 ER 圖(3) 書店客戶(客戶號(hào),用戶名,密碼,真實(shí)姓名,聯(lián)系電話,地址,電子郵箱):storeuserusernamepasswordnametelphoneaddressid 圖 書店客戶 ER 圖(4) 訂單(訂單號(hào),生成時(shí)間,運(yùn)輸方式,付款方式,總價(jià)):orderspaymentcostidtimedelivery 圖 訂單 ER 圖(5) 訂單條目(訂單條目號(hào),總價(jià),單價(jià)):orderdetail countprice 圖 訂單條目 ER 圖 ER圖 storeuserOrderbookdetailbook擁有包含包含包含n1n1nn1bookcat1 圖 總 ER 圖id 以下的表是分析完 ER 圖后所設(shè)計(jì)出來,每張表存放一類信息: (1)書目類別 (書目類別號(hào),類別名) (2)書(書號(hào),書目類別號(hào),書名,價(jià)格,銷售價(jià)格,描述,圖片,內(nèi)容,作者) (3)書店客戶 (客戶號(hào),用戶名,密碼,真實(shí)姓名,聯(lián)系電話,地址,電子郵箱) (4)訂單(訂單號(hào),客戶號(hào),生產(chǎn)訂單時(shí)間,運(yùn)輸方式,付款方式,總價(jià)) (5)訂單條目 (訂單條目號(hào),訂單號(hào),書號(hào),總價(jià),單價(jià))代碼如下://圖書分類基本信息表CREATE TABLE bookcat(id NUMBER PRIMARY KEY,catname VARCHAR2(40) NOT NULL)。//圖書基本信息表 DROP TABLE book CASCADE CONSTRAINTS。CREATE TABLE book(id NUMBER PRIMARY KEY,catid NUMBER NOT NULLREFERENCES bookcat(id) ON DELETE CASCADE,name VARCHAR2(50) NOT NULL,price NUMBER NOT NULL,saleprice NUMBER NOT NULL,descript VARCHAR2(500) NOT NULL,author VARCHAR2(50) NOT NULL,contents VARCHAR2(2022) NULL,image VARCHAR2(50) NULL)。//客戶基本信息表 DROP TABLE storeuser CASCADE CONSTRAINTS。CREATE TABLE storeuser(id NUMBER PRIMARY KEY,username VARCHAR2(20) NOT NULL,password VARCHAR2(20) NOT NULL,name VARCHAR2(20) NOT NULL,tel VARCHAR2(20) NOT NULL, VARCHAR2(50) NULL address,VARCHAR2(100) NOT NULL )。//訂單信息表 DROP TABLE orders CASCADE CONSTRAINTS。CREATE TABLE orders(id NUMBER PRIMARY KEY,user_id NUMBER NOT NULLREFERENCES storeuser(id) ON DELETE CASCADE,time DATE NOT NULL,delivery VARCHAR2(20) NOT NULL,payment VARCHAR2(20) NOT NULL,cost NUMBER)。//訂單條目詳細(xì)信息表DROP TABLE orderdetail CASCADE CONSTRAINTS。CREATE TABLE orderdetail(id NUMBER PRIMARY KEY,orderid NUMBER NOT NULLREFERENCES orders(id) ON DELETE CASCADE,bookid NUMBER NOT NULLREFERENCES book(id) ON DELETE CASCADE,count NUMBER NOT NULL,price NUMBER NOT NULL)。 網(wǎng)上書店基本流程網(wǎng)上書店在運(yùn)行過程中頁(yè)面的基本流程如圖 : 網(wǎng)上書店各頁(yè)面功能詳細(xì)功能及描述:(1)獲取圖書分類信息以及圖書基本信息集合(2)提交顯示指定分類圖書信息的請(qǐng)求,同時(shí)傳遞對(duì)應(yīng)圖書分類編號(hào), (3)提交書目搜索請(qǐng)求及搜索條件的表單(4)提交搜索關(guān)鍵字的表單元素圖書查詢圖書詳情顯示購(gòu)物車管理會(huì)員登錄會(huì)員地址確認(rèn)generateordersucce訂單生成新會(huì)員注冊(cè)訂單確認(rèn)圖 網(wǎng)上書店基本流程圖(5)選擇搜索條件的表單元素(6)顯示圖書記錄總數(shù)、當(dāng)前頁(yè)面編號(hào)以及總頁(yè)數(shù)(7)顯示圖書名稱、價(jià)格、銷售價(jià)格、作者信息(8)提交顯示圖書詳細(xì)信息請(qǐng)求的超鏈接 (9)提交分頁(yè)顯示請(qǐng)求的超鏈接 詳細(xì)功能及描述: (1)依據(jù)圖書記錄編號(hào)獲取待顯示詳細(xì)信息的圖書類型的對(duì)象 (2)分別顯示該圖書對(duì)象的詳細(xì)信息 (3)顯示圖書封面圖片、名稱、詳細(xì)介紹、價(jià)格、銷售價(jià)格 (4)單擊“購(gòu)買”按鈕后,將提交放入購(gòu)物車的請(qǐng)求 (5)顯示圖書目錄本頁(yè)面是在控制器響應(yīng)了網(wǎng)上書店主頁(yè)提交的查看圖書詳細(xì)信息請(qǐng)求,即“”請(qǐng)求后,跳轉(zhuǎn)到的頁(yè)面。在該頁(yè)面中將獲取到的指定圖書詳細(xì)信息顯示出來,同時(shí)如果用戶單擊“購(gòu)買”按鈕,將提交“?bookId=%=()%”請(qǐng)求,進(jìn)行后續(xù)放入購(gòu)物車的處理。 詳細(xì)功能及描述:(1)獲取該用戶購(gòu)物車中信息的集合(2)提交更新購(gòu)物車請(qǐng)求的表單(3)循環(huán)顯示購(gòu)物車中的每一條購(gòu)物記錄信息(4)設(shè)置購(gòu)買數(shù)量的文本框(5)顯示圖書銷售價(jià)格(6)顯示圖書總價(jià)(7)從購(gòu)物車中移除購(gòu)買記錄信息(8)更新訂單按鈕(9)提交繼續(xù)購(gòu)書請(qǐng)求的超鏈接(10)提交清空購(gòu)物車請(qǐng)求的超鏈接(11)提交結(jié)算付款請(qǐng)求的超鏈接 本頁(yè)面是在用戶選擇購(gòu)買某種圖書商品后,進(jìn)入的頁(yè)面。在該頁(yè)面中將顯示該用戶購(gòu)物車中現(xiàn)有的所有購(gòu)買需求記錄。同時(shí)提供更新購(gòu)物車的操作界面,例如,可以輸入購(gòu)買數(shù)量或者選擇刪除購(gòu)買記錄。單擊“更新訂單”按鈕后,將提交“”請(qǐng)求,進(jìn)行更新購(gòu)物車信息的處理。此外,也可以單擊“繼續(xù)購(gòu)書”按鈕,提交“”請(qǐng)求返回網(wǎng)上書店主頁(yè)面繼續(xù)購(gòu)書,或者單擊“清空購(gòu)物車”按鈕提交“”請(qǐng)求。同時(shí),如果用戶確認(rèn)去收銀臺(tái),則可以單擊“結(jié)算付款”按鈕跳轉(zhuǎn)到“”頁(yè)面進(jìn)行用戶登錄。 詳細(xì)功能及描述:(1)提交用戶登錄請(qǐng)求,同時(shí)提交登錄用戶信息的表單(2)提交登錄用戶用戶名及密碼的表單元素(3)登錄按鈕(4)提交新用戶注冊(cè)請(qǐng)求的超鏈接本頁(yè)面是客戶在購(gòu)物車頁(yè)面單擊“結(jié)算付款”按鈕后跳轉(zhuǎn)過來的頁(yè)面,在該頁(yè)面中,用戶在表單中輸入用戶名及密碼,單擊“用戶登錄”按鈕后,將提交“”請(qǐng)求,以便于進(jìn)行后續(xù)獲取用戶相關(guān)信息的處理,對(duì)于沒有用戶身份的新客戶,可以在本頁(yè)面中單擊“新用戶注冊(cè)”按鈕,跳轉(zhuǎn)到“”頁(yè)面進(jìn)行用戶注冊(cè)。 網(wǎng)上書店客戶注冊(cè) 詳細(xì)功能及描述:(1)提交新用戶注冊(cè)請(qǐng)求,同時(shí)提交新用戶注冊(cè)信息的表單(2)提交注冊(cè)用戶姓名、地址、電子郵件地址、電話、用戶名、密碼以及確認(rèn)密碼的表單元素(3)注冊(cè)按鈕在本頁(yè)面中注冊(cè)用戶可以在表單中輸入對(duì)應(yīng)的注冊(cè)信息,在單擊“注冊(cè)”按鈕后,將提交“”請(qǐng)求,同時(shí)提交新用戶的相關(guān)注冊(cè)信息,以便于進(jìn)行后續(xù)新用戶注冊(cè)的處理。、付款方式及訂單信息 詳細(xì)功能及描述:(1)獲取客戶信息(2)提交選擇送貨方式及付款方式的表單(3)顯示客戶信息、姓名、地址、電話、送貨方式、付款方式(4)獲取購(gòu)物車信息集合(5)獲取訂單信息、客戶信息(6)顯示客戶姓名、地址、電話(7)顯示購(gòu)物車中的信息(8)顯示所購(gòu)圖書書名、數(shù)量、總價(jià)(9)顯示整張訂單總價(jià)本頁(yè)面是在用戶登錄通過后,跳轉(zhuǎn)到的頁(yè)面,在該頁(yè)面中首先獲取對(duì)應(yīng)用戶的客戶資料,同時(shí)提供送貨方式,付款方式及訂單信息的選擇,在用戶單擊“確認(rèn)”按鈕后,將提交“”請(qǐng)求,生成生續(xù)完整的訂單信息。 顯示訂單生成成功信息 詳細(xì)功能及描述:(1)顯示訂單生成成功信息(2)生成訂單號(hào)本頁(yè)面將顯示訂單成功生成的信息。 bean 采用了 Struts 架構(gòu)下提供的數(shù)據(jù)庫(kù)連接池建立與數(shù)據(jù)庫(kù)的連接,在該 bean中通過構(gòu)造方法建立與數(shù)據(jù)庫(kù)的連接,并提供了相應(yīng)的方法完成數(shù)據(jù)庫(kù)中的查詢、更新等操作,同時(shí)也提供了關(guān)閉數(shù)據(jù)庫(kù)連接的方法,以便于及時(shí)釋放資源。 業(yè)務(wù)邏輯層各 bean功能在本系統(tǒng)的業(yè)務(wù)邏輯層中分別完成了對(duì)圖書信息、圖書分類信息、購(gòu)物車信息、訂單信息以及客戶信息等類型對(duì)象的保存和處理。所有文件包含在 WEBINF\classes 目錄中。 封裝了圖書處理的 bean()除聲明了與圖書基本數(shù)據(jù)相關(guān)的基本屬性和方法之外,還提供了圖書信息的查詢顯示處理相關(guān)的幾個(gè)方法。其中在調(diào)用查詢滿足條件的圖書信息方法時(shí),需要提供查詢的依據(jù),例如,分類、按作者還是按書名,對(duì)應(yīng)關(guān)鍵字等。 bean()為了能夠簡(jiǎn)化類的定義,考慮到購(gòu)物車中所需要處理的圖書基本信息與圖書類型對(duì)象中封裝的信息相同,只是需要再補(bǔ)充上購(gòu)買數(shù)量即可,因此在定義該類時(shí)繼承了圖書信息類。 封裝了訂單住處處理的 bean( java)除聲明了與訂單中所需要處理的數(shù)據(jù)相關(guān)的基本屬性和方法之外,還提供了與訂單查詢、插入及刪除處理相關(guān)的幾個(gè)方法。此外,也提供了計(jì)算該訂單所涉及總金額的方法。 封裝了客記信息處理的 bean()除聲明了與用戶數(shù)據(jù)相關(guān)的基本屬性和方法之外,還提供了與確認(rèn)用戶身份、獲取用戶相關(guān)信息、插入新用戶信息處理相關(guān)的幾個(gè)方法。 bean()除了聲明了與圖書分類數(shù)據(jù)相關(guān)的基本屬性和方法之外,還提供了與圖書分類信息查詢及顯示處理相關(guān)的幾個(gè)方法。 控制處理層下表是網(wǎng)上書店系統(tǒng)中的 Action 映射表。該映射決定了 Action 與其他Web 組件之間的關(guān)聯(lián)關(guān)系。作為前后臺(tái)之間橋梁,本表中指明了每個(gè) Action 的入口(即調(diào)用 Action 的組件)及出口(即請(qǐng)求轉(zhuǎn)發(fā)的目標(biāo)組件) ,以及傳遞Action 的 ActionForm。表 action 控制表Action 入口 ActionForm 出口AddItemToCartAction BookDetailAction BookSearchAction CartAction GenerateOrderAction UserForm loginAction loginForm OrderAddAction PageCtrlAction RegistAction (1)該程序負(fù)責(zé)處理增加購(gòu)買的圖書時(shí)的“”請(qǐng)求(2)該程序是個(gè)多匹配的 Action,負(fù)責(zé)處理四個(gè)功能,分別是:清除購(gòu)物車時(shí)提交的“”請(qǐng)求;結(jié)帳時(shí)提交的“”請(qǐng)求;修改購(gòu)物車?yán)镏付ㄉ唐返臄?shù)量時(shí)提交的“”請(qǐng)求;刪除購(gòu)物車?yán)镏付l目的“”請(qǐng)求。(3)BookDetailAction該程序負(fù)責(zé)處理顯示指定圖書編號(hào)的對(duì)應(yīng)圖書詳細(xì)信息時(shí)提交的“”請(qǐng)求。(4)BookSearchAction該程序負(fù)責(zé)處理從圖書主頁(yè)面提交的""請(qǐng)求,根據(jù)搜索的條件進(jìn)行搜索。(5)GenerateOrderAction該程序負(fù)責(zé)處理從訂單信息頁(yè)面提交的""請(qǐng)求,把訂單信息存入數(shù)據(jù)庫(kù)。(6)loginAction該程序負(fù)責(zé)處理從用戶登錄頁(yè)面提交的“”請(qǐng)求。(7)OrderAddAction該程序負(fù)責(zé)處理從購(gòu)物車頁(yè)面提交的""請(qǐng)求,根據(jù)用戶是否登陸來判斷所要轉(zhuǎn)向的頁(yè)面。(8)PageCtrlAction該程序負(fù)責(zé)處理從主頁(yè)面提交的””的分頁(yè)信息.根據(jù)所點(diǎn)擊的按紐進(jìn)行回首頁(yè)、上一頁(yè)、下一頁(yè)的處理。(9)RegisterAction該程序負(fù)責(zé)處理從新用戶注冊(cè)頁(yè)面提交的“”請(qǐng)求。4 網(wǎng)上書店的實(shí)現(xiàn)本網(wǎng)上書店系統(tǒng)共分為四個(gè)功能模塊,分別為:用戶管理,商品查詢,訂單管理,商品購(gòu)買。各模塊的實(shí)現(xiàn)如下: 本模塊提供了用戶登錄功能,用戶注冊(cè)功能。新用戶通過點(diǎn)擊”注
點(diǎn)擊復(fù)制文檔內(nèi)容
教學(xué)教案相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1